Summary: Nestled in the beautiful rocky mountains is historic Ferncliff, Colorado. Come experience wellness in the wild and your home away from home with luxury linens/amenities, a private hot tub and a large family friendly cabin with everything you could need to escape to the mountains. The lodge is perfect for family gatherings as well as retreats. The Ferncliff Lodge aims to allow guests to escape the fast paced city life and relax for a few nights. Ferncliff sits a bit over an hour away from Denver, CO as well as just 20 minutes away from the town of Estes Park and Rocky Mountain National Park, known for their rustic mountain charm and incredible hiking/sightseeing.
The Space: The Ferncliff Lodge offers 5 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ms that can fit up to 10 people comfortably. The cabin boasts a large kitchen fit for the whole family and dining room area fit with a historic piano. The living room offers a huge couch area with a bookshelf full of unique books and our personal record collection with over 200 options to choose from, as well as a wood burning fireplace and 65" smart TV. 3 of the bedrooms are downstairs while 2 are upstairs. Lastly the expansive backyard area offers a private hot tub with plenty of fenced in grass area to explore.

The Neighborhood: Directly across the street from the property there's Ferncliff Food & Fuel, which is a small supermarket and gas station for any essential needs. In the summer, they're fully stocked with everything from toiletries to meats and pizza. There is also a laundromat across the street as well as a a liquor store with a great selection and 2 fuel pumps. There's a back entrance to Rocky Mountain Park a few minutes down the road as well as the entrance to Long's Peak. Within 15 minutes you'll find some of the best hiking and wildlife Colorado has to offer.
Getting Around: We recommend renting or bringing a car to best explore the surrounding areas. There isn't any public transit in the area until you get to Estes Park or Lyons. During the winter months, we strongly recommend a AWD or 4WD car whenever going to the mountains.
Other Things to Note: Ferncliff isn't a big mountain town, so we recommend bringing anything you need with you for your stay. If you forget anything, there's always the market across the street. Ferncliff is a rural town which means there's no cell service, but we do have high speed Starlink Internet on the property.

As promised, this large cabin is nestled in the mountains in a tiny town away from the hustle-n-bustle of tourism. The kitchen/dining/living space and each of the 5 bedrooms were spacious enough for a multi-family get-together. There were plenty of dishes, silverware and glasses + a fully equipped kitchen for cooking meals (but no microwave to nuke any leftovers - instead, there is a toaster oven). The kitchen and 2 showers are beautifully remodeled. Bathrooms are a bit limited on space but well stocked with shampoo/conditioner/body wash/facial tissue/bath tissue. The hot tub and wood fireplace were the highlights for us; however, one of the hot tub's jets was malfunctioning so only half the hot tub bubbled. **IMPORTANT: I highly recommend you do ALL of your grocery and supply shopping before coming; once you arrive, your retail options are very limited. Understandably, firewood from the shop across the street is limited to 3 small bundles per day. Bring water; a 24pk of bottled water at the shop was pricey. ALSO, be sure to screenshot the door passcode when you receive it; there's NO CELL SERVICE to check your email or instructions or make calls once you arrive to the cabin (there is wifi once you get in). I plugged "Ferncliff Food & Fuel" into GPS and got there with no problems. The host was more than accommodating, quick to address questions and concerns.
